Egyptian FM: Palestinian rights must be respected, no to displacement or transfer

Egyptian Foreign Minister Dr Badr Abdel Aty stressed the importance of preserving the rights of the Palestinian people, who are determined to remain on their land and reject any displacement or transfer beyond it. He emphasised the necessity of respecting their resilience and their right to self-determination, as per a Foreign Ministry statement on Wednesday.
This came during a phone call on Tuesday evening, with his US counterpart, Mr Marco Rubio. The two ministers discussed the close strategic partnership between their countries and their shared desire to advance bilateral cooperation across various fields, contributing to strengthening the partnership and enhancing efforts to address multiple regional challenges.
The two ministers reviewed developments in implementing the ceasefire agreement in Gaza. Minister Abdel Aty underlined the importance of all parties to the agreement adhering to its three-phase implementation, facilitating the exchange of hostages and prisoners, enabling the Palestinian people to return to their homes, and ensuring the sustainable delivery of humanitarian aid to the Gaza Strip. He stressed that these steps are fundamental to restoring calm and stability and shaping a political horizon that contributes to ending the Palestinian-Israeli conflict based on the two-state solution and in accordance with international legitimacy.
